"Epigraph" styles result in text overlap for long epigraphs in frontmatter #120

See attached PDF sample.
Pages from 9780765391421_POD.pdf

This is the result from using the "Epigraph - verse (epiv)" and "Epigraph Source (epis)" styles. If "FM Epigraph - verse (fmepiv)" and "FM Epigraph Source (fmepis)" are used instead, the long epigraph correctly runs to two pages, so this isn't an urgent issue.
